“I used to care about how buildings looked on the outside,” says Malcolm Wells, a charming, self-deprecating man with a bushy beard
that is more salt than pepper. “Phew, that was so self-centered of me. Now I care only about the physical effects of architecture.”

Hillary Geronemus
Wells’ exterior designs for two houses with the same floor plan were published by Popular Science in 1989.
